This is an exciting opportunity to join a global organization as a Customer Services Specialist responsible for the day-to-day operational management of assigned functions with our outsource partners. This includes indirect management of team leaders within our outsource partners, to drive SLA and process adherence.

Responsibilities:

  • Supports the Service Outsourcing Manager with the ongoing optimisation of the Services and Support outsourced operations for all aspects of the Canon business through involvement in multiple improvement projects.
  • Guards the overall operational performance of the outsource partners and ensures that all necessary targets and goals are being achieved by both internal and external parties. In cases where this is not happening, raises the issue via appropriate channels to ensure adequate and speedy resolution.
  • Act in the capacity of Subject Matter Expert, both of procedures and systems utilised by teams within your sphere.
  • Work with outsource partner to ensure smooth implementation of all agreed process changes. Ensure that all process changes are approved and documented.
  • Respond to and resolve enquiries, complaints or requests that are escalated through the outsource partner and via internal stakeholders, ensuring a high level of customer service is maintained. Review each for process and performance improvements.
  • Identifies gaps in training received by all applicable outsource partner staff and ensures that these are adequately picked up by the necessary training resources.
  • Ensures all outsource partner policies and procedures are fully documented, up-to-date and clearly communicated to all necessary staff. This includes any new procedures which need to be created or implemented as a result of a business requirement.
  • Ensures processes and procedures are being followed and applied consistently across all outsource partner operation
